Re: Game Thread: Pistons vs Hornets: Nov. 15/06

I'm pretty upset because we could've had this one. Our effort first half was just bad, we were shooting 55% or something and we were still down 11. We started the second half well and started the fourth well but they climbed back and took it. The main story here is rebounds, they killed us, and this is without Tyson Chandler. They didn't even shoot that well, they just got so many more shot opportunities because they hit the offensive boards and we didn't (we could've had the last possession, but the guy who was shooting fouls shots got his own offensive rebound, I think). We did make whoever Hilton Armstrong is look really impressive, though.

Our bench was terrible tonight, 11 points, six of them were McDyess's (he was fine for the most part, although he rebounded poorly). Hunter, Murray, and the rest basically didn't do anything.

3-5 now, next up is Washington. Hopefully we won't get embarassed on national television again.

Re: Game Thread: Pistons vs Hornets: Nov. 15/06

Very, very poor coaching at the end of the game.

We go small to finish, with Chauncey, Rip, Tayshaun, Sheed, and then Flip/Lindsey. I don't like it, but whatever.

The real question is, with 4 seconds left in the game and Hilton Armstrong on the free throw line, no matter what happens you are calling a timeout after the freethrows right? So why in the blue hell do you not sub some rebounders in to make sure you actually rebound a missed free throw !?!?!?!?!

What was the point of having Sheed and Tayshaun on the lowest spots, and Chauncey on the next one? If Tayshaun takes Chauncey's spot, and Dale Davis or Nazi takes Tayshaun's spot, that last free throw doesn't get tipped out. Then you call timeout and get your offensive group in the game.

That's just unbelievably lazy coaching.
